What does a Warehouse Associate do? Grimco Warehouse Associates are responsible for operating a forklift and other material handling equipment for the purpose of accurate shipping, processing and receiving, which includes but is not limited to unloading, scanning, moving, staging, loading, locating, relocating, and stacking product. Warehouse associates are also responsible for repackaging product when necessary, counting and inspecting product, and notifying the appropriate person when product is damaged. Warehouse Associates are accountable for the safe and efficient operation of the all equipment and will be expected to perform all duties as directed by Management. All work performed by Warehouse Associates must meet company standards of safety, security, and productivity. This role is located at Grimco Winnipeg and the hours of work are Monday to Friday 8:30am - 5:00pm. Responsibilities:
  • Pick and pack orders of sign supplies by hand, in preparation for shipping to customers in compliance with material handling procedures. Attention to detail is critical!
  • Load and unload delivery trucks both by hand and using a forklift.
  • Stock inventory when replenishment shipments come in.
  • Receive and examine incoming material for discrepancies/damages.
  • Record shipping/receiving logs in an orderly fashion.
  • Perform accurate cycle counts of inventory.
  • Ship and receive orders using appropriate shipping software.
  • Use data management system to track orders and answer questions for team members and customers alike.
  • Assist couriers and delivery drivers with manifest information and work in order to maximize delivery efficiency.
  • Perform duties using a safety-conscious attitude, improving safety knowledge of all employees.
  • Operate forklift.
  • Maintain a clean work area.
  • Perform other duties as assigned (cleaning/sweeping warehouse, maintenance, special projects, etc.).
